Overview

p53MVA is a cancer vaccine based on a recombinant Modified Vaccinia Ankara (MVA) viral vector engineered to express the full-length wild-type human tumor suppressor protein p53. The primary mechanism involves delivering the wild-type human p53 gene to antigen-presenting cells via the MVA vector, which leads to expression and presentation of multiple antigenic determinants of p53 on different HLA molecules. This process aims to stimulate robust CD8+ T cell responses against tumors that overexpress or present mutated forms of p53. Preclinical and early clinical studies have shown that immunization with p53MVA can induce anti-tumor immunity and activate cytolytic T cells specific for wild-type human p53 epitopes. The vaccine has been evaluated alone and in combination with immune checkpoint inhibitors such as pembrolizumab in patients with advanced solid tumors including gastrointestinal cancers, breast cancer, pancreatic cancer, hepatocellular carcinoma, head and neck cancer, ovarian cancer, primary peritoneal cancer, fallopian tube cancer, and other solid tumors[1][2][3][4][5].
